North Elm shooting suspect gains new attorney

Marshawn Taylor, the man accused in a shooting in Many of 2021 that happened on North Elm Street, has a new attorney.

In Christian Circuit Court Monday morning, public defender Eric Bearden entered in his appearance as Taylor’s new attorney and informed the court he needed more time to speak with his client, receive the evidence in the case and then go over it.

With the hope he will have everything he needs by that time, Circuit Judge Andrew Self set a pretrial conference for December 4, where they will possibly set a trial date.

Taylor is currently serving a sentence in a state facility on separate charges. Taylor allegedly shot 27-year-old Marka Smith of Owensboro in the wrist and hip while she was sitting in a vehicle in the 100 block of North Elm in May of 2021. He’s charged with assault in the first-degree, first-degree wanton endangerment and possession of a handgun by a convicted felon.
